Alterations of striatal phosphodiesterase 10 A and their association with recurrence rate in bipolar I disorder
Abstract Phosphodiesterase 10 A (PDE10A), a pivotal element of the second messenger signaling downstream of the dopamine receptor stimulation, is conceived to be crucially involved in the mood instability of bipolar I disorder (BD-I) as a primary causal factor or in response to dysregulated dopamine...
